any one have hks bovs? if so does your blow off when shifting 1st through 4th? seems weird to me for an automatic and my agency power ones never did
 
My tial bov does blow off sometimes when its a late shift.
My hypothesis is that the factory tune lowering power before a redline shift may redice pressure just enough for a release of pressure
 
any one have hks bovs? if so does your blow off when shifting 1st through 4th? seems weird to me for an automatic and my agency power ones never did
The BOV gets a signal through a solenoid to blow off and seems it does this to reduce power during shifts under heavy throttle.
I have the GFB and it blows during shifts under heavy throttle, it is adjustable, so I might try and adjust it to blow less to try and maintain a little more boost during shifts.
